Sarah was born in Maryland[1][2][3] in 1806[4] (or 1807[3][1], or 1808[2]). She migrated to Nelson Co., Kentucky with the rest of her family around 1820. By 1832, she had moved on the Perry Co., Indiana with her mother and three siblings.
Sarah and Walter resided in Perry Co. for the rest of their lives and are buried in Old St. John's Cemetery.

Children
For future use, the sources below indicate that Sarah had these children:
Thomas, David, James, Matilda, Zacharias, Mary, Hanna, John, Anna.
